Transaction 7a77800663a1604fd3a1268cd2c66fd8aec7c01a1f7f18ccdf17e8156fb4e839

1 Input
2 Outputs
  • 7a77800663a1604fd3a1268cd2c66fd8aec7c01a1f7f18ccdf17e8156fb4e839:0
  • value  42885
    address  3GDSzexsUg4igd2RuCCn6cUCsPYKoihryY
  • 7a77800663a1604fd3a1268cd2c66fd8aec7c01a1f7f18ccdf17e8156fb4e839:1
  • value  150756
    address  bc1q3n0rhut5feqjsnzv205vuny9hmax80yhwnwltl